Solution for (q+7)*4=32 equation:


Simplifying
(q + 7) * 4 = 32

Reorder the terms:
(7 + q) * 4 = 32

Reorder the terms for easier multiplication:
4(7 + q) = 32
(7 * 4 + q * 4) = 32
(28 + 4q) = 32

Solving
28 + 4q = 32

Solving for variable 'q'.

Move all terms containing q to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-28' to each side of the equation.
28 + -28 + 4q = 32 + -28

Combine like terms: 28 + -28 = 0
0 + 4q = 32 + -28
4q = 32 + -28

Combine like terms: 32 + -28 = 4
4q = 4

Divide each side by '4'.
q = 1

Simplifying
q = 1
